Common sources of noise in home sewing

There are several common culprits behind loud sewing sessions. The motor and drive system can emit a constant hum that grows louder with speed. The drive belt, if worn or loose, introduces flutter or whine. The needle interacting with fabric can produce squeaks if the needle size or fabric type is mismatched. The bobbin area and lint buildup can rattle, while the feed dogs and shuttle mechanisms may rattle under tension. Loose screws, a poorly seated machine, or an unstable table amplify vibration and increase overall noise. Finally, electrical connections and the foot pedal can contribute a soft buzz. If you are asking are sewing machines loud, you’ll often find a combination of these factors rather than a single issue. Regular inspection and cleaning often quiet the most common offenders.

Practical steps to reduce noise during sewing

Reducing noise starts with a quick assessment and a few practical adjustments. First, clean lint from the bobbin area and feed mechanism, then tighten any loose screws or mounting hardware. Use the correct needle for the fabric and ensure the thread tension is balanced; a mismatched needle can cause higher vibration. Check the drive belt for wear and proper tension, replacing it if it shows signs of cracking or glazing. Follow the manufacturer’s lubrication guidelines to avoid excess oil that collects lint. Place the machine on a stable, vibration-absorbing mat or under-matted surface to dampen resonance, and consider slower sewing when appropriate. Reducing speed while maintaining stitch quality often lowers perceived loudness. All these steps can drastically cut are sewing machines loud without affecting results.

Maintenance and care for quieter operation

Quieter operation comes from a proactive maintenance routine. Regular cleaning of lint and dust prevents rattling and binding, while timely lubrication of moving parts minimizes friction and noise. Periodic inspection of bearings, gears, and the hook area helps catch wear before it becomes a bigger issue. Use only the lubricants recommended by your machine’s manual to avoid gum buildup that can amplify noise. If you notice increased noise after a service, revisit alignment and tension. In the long run, keeping the machine clean, properly oiled, and securely mounted is one of the most reliable ways to keep are sewing machines loud under control.

Choosing a quieter model or setup

When shopping for a quieter machine, look for features that reduce vibration and improve stability. A solid metal frame can dampen resonance compared with a lightweight plastic chassis. Brushless motors and rigid drive systems tend to run smoother and with less mechanical chatter. Some models offer built in noise dampening enclosures or specialized feet designed to minimize vibration. Think about where the machine will live; a sturdy, purpose-built table with locking legs and a heavy mat under it can dramatically cut factory noise. Although no machine is completely silent, a well-built unit with good setup will be noticeably quieter, making it easier to work for long sessions without becoming fatigued by the sound.

When to seek professional service and what it means for long term health

If you notice a dramatic increase in noise that accompanies new vibrations, odors, or changes in stitch quality, it is wise to consult a professional. Sudden loudness can indicate belt failure, bearing wear, or misalignment of moving parts that require inspection. A technician can measure noise patterns, identify root causes, and perform safe adjustments or replacements. Regular professional maintenance, in addition to your at‑home care, helps preserve machine health and keeps the noise level predictable. Remember that addressing noise early protects the long term health of your sewing machine and prevents more costly repairs later.
